Transaction e6a43b2667a374553a1a016d003ebd8d167cd821498c6c7f4b79b704458a7b79
1 Input
1 Output
-
e6a43b2667a374553a1a016d003ebd8d167cd821498c6c7f4b79b704458a7b79:0
- value
- 21023967
- script pubkey
- OP_0 OP_PUSHBYTES_20 76a96056ab5edb8ef55dc7fc718fec0a2eceecd8
- address
- bc1qw65kq44ttmdcaa2acl78rrlvpghvamxcn2xkdn